How Do People Know if They are a Candidate for Liposuction?
A person who is considering liposuction should not be morbidly obese. Ideally, the best candidates for liposuction are within 30 percent of the bodyweight that they want to reach.
The best candidates for liposuction have firm skin that has not lost a significant amount of its elasticity. It is important to have good muscle tone as well when a patient is considering the liposuction procedure.
People who are considering liposuction should not smoke cigarettes. If they are currently smoking, they should make an effort to quit prior to having the procedure performed by a cosmetic surgeon.
In addition to being physically healthy, a person considering liposuction should also be mentally prepared for the operation. A positive outlook is especially important, and the patient should have realistic goals when it comes to the liposuction procedure.
How Do People Know if They are a Good Candidate for the Tummy Tuck?
The best candidates for the tummy tuck have attempted to lose weight through traditional methods, but are not pleased with appearance because of lack of muscle tone and sagging skin.
As this is a major surgical procedure, all candidates should be in good general health and able to withstand the surgery itself as well as the recovery period after the fact.
As with any other cosmetic surgery procedure, patients must have realistic expectations of what this surgery can achieve. The tummy tuck will help tone muscles in the abdominal area and remove excess skin, helping the patient to enjoy a firmer, more defined waist line.
